    I have a fairly new less than one year old Troy Built HP 6.5 electric self propelled mower I bought at Lowe's. I put too much oil in it and it started to smoke so I immediately shut it off called Lowe's and was told to empty out the oil and I did. Now I can't get get the rope to pull and I don't know where the charger is to it. What can I do. I called the company and was told the warranty would not cover it if I put too much oil in it. Should I keep trying to pull the rope? Will I hurt the motor? Thanks so much for your help. C

    OK, if I hope I'm reading wrong. Do this:

    1. Make the oil level normal. Add wait (5-10 min). Check if dipstick.

    2. remove the spark plug.

    3. Spray carb cleaner in spark plug hole

    4. With rag over hole, pull rope a few times. Spary and repeat until muck is gone

    5. Get a new plug.

    6. Try starting the mower normally.
